What Are Bay Windows?
A bay window is a multi-faceted window plan that typically protrudes from the primary walls of a building. It consists of a main window that is generally flanked by two smaller windows at an angle. This design permits larger views and can create extra interior space.
Advantages of Bay Windows
- Increased Natural Light: The extensive design of bay windows permits increased sunlight in a room, reducing the requirement for artificial lighting.
- Improved Aesthetics: Bay windows can serve as a centerpiece for both the exterior and interior of a home.
- Added Space: The design frequently develops a little nook or seating area, adding functional area without needing a significant remodel.
- Enhanced Ventilation: When opened, the windows promote much better airflow through the space.

The Installation Process
Comprehending the installation process can help homeowners set reasonable expectations. Here's a breakdown of what to expect:
Consultation and Evaluation
- A contractor will visit your home to discuss your specific needs, spending plan, and choices. They will evaluate the existing structure to determine expediency.
Design and Planning
- Following the evaluation, the specialist will help establish a design plan, consisting of measurements, window styles, and products.
Permit Acquisition
- Depending upon local regulations, authorizations may be needed before proceeding with installation.
Preparation of the Installation Area
- This step includes removing existing windows and preparing the location to ensure appropriate installation of the brand-new bay window.
Installation
- The actual installation process typically takes one to 2 days, depending upon the complexity.
Last Touches and Cleanup
- After installation, the professional will seal the windows and guarantee they function appropriately. Cleanup of the workspace is likewise part of the process.

Frequently Asked Questions About Bay Window Contractors
1. How do I find a reliable bay window contractor?
Start by seeking suggestions from friends or family, or inspect local listings online for respectable contractors. Reading evaluations on platforms such as Yelp or Google can likewise help evaluate their efficiency.
2. What should I anticipate to pay for bay window installation?
Costs can differ extensively based on size, product, and labor expenses. On average, homeowners can anticipate to pay in between ₤ 1,000 and ₤ 5,000 for bay window installation.
3. How long will the installation take?
A lot of bay window setups can be completed in one to two days, although additional time might be needed for preparation and permits.
4. Are bay windows energy-efficient?
Modern bay windows can be highly energy-efficient, specifically those with double or triple-pane glass. It's always a good concept to look for energy-efficient certifications when selecting windows.
5. Can I install bay windows myself?
While some property owners might try DIY installation, it is typically recommended to hire a professional specialist. Correct installation is critical for window performance and sturdiness.
